Nanostructured and Molecule-Based Magnetic Materials | |||
This session will provide a general overview of chemical methods for the preparation of magnetic nanoparticles and nanorods and of self-assembling molecule-based materials. The use of these materials in various biomedical and magnetic recording applications will be discussed. | |||
